The F1® 25 Racenet league system has several ongoing issues that make it very difficult to consistently organize and run league races. The main problems and suggestions for improvement are as follows. I've tried almost everything to fix it, like restarting my PC, relaunching the game, repairing the game files, and resetting my internet connection. Despite that, this issue isn't just happening to me, but to a large, unspecified number of other users. On some days, one person can't connect, and on other days, it's someone else. It's difficult to find a day when everyone's connection is stable. 1. Unstable Racenet Servers and System Persistent Connection Errors: Both On-Demand and Scheduled leagues consistently experience connection issues, with 3 to 4 out of 20 players failing to join. This includes recurring bugs like a QR code screen appearing or getting stuck in an infinite loading loop. Unpredictable Bug Recurrence: This problem has persisted for months. The bugs occasionally seem to be resolved, only to unexpectedly return and ruin planned races. 2. Functional Limitations of F1 World Multiplayer No Password Protection: Since F1 World multiplayer lobbies lack a password feature, league organizers are forced to use private lobbies or limit the number of players, which is highly inconvenient. Inability to Join Mid-Session: As a result, players who are even 1-2 minutes late to a race cannot join the qualifying session, which disrupts the league's integrity. 3. Inefficient League System Management On-Demand League Player Limit: It is hard to understand why the maximum player count for On-Demand leagues is limited to 20. This should be increased to 1000 or more to encourage spontaneous, large-scale races. Scheduled League Registration and Edit Deadlines: The system is extremely inconvenient due to its strict deadlines—registration closes 30 minutes before the start, and tier edits are locked 20 minutes before. Players should be able to edit their tiers right up until the last minute. 4. Fundamental Solutions and Suggestions The most urgent solution is to add a password feature to F1 World multiplayer. This single addition would resolve most of the current inconveniences. Furthermore, the developers should work on strengthening the overall stability of the Racenet system. Introducing a 'reserve' feature that allows empty spots in any tier to be filled by waiting players would also make league management significantly smoother.20Views0likes0CommentsPerma showing "comunicating with online services"

I take part in a league where we use Multiplayer cars. There is one glaring ommission that Codemasters have never input into the game and I do not know why. Why is there no setting/indication as to who your teammate is? You just have to play roulette with the gods when it comes to pitting or qualifying. Please can you/they implement the car select into lobby settings like you do when using authentic cars. So you can choose your team mate. It doesn't seem to be a hard fix but its never been in the game since they added multiplayer liveries.17Views0likes0CommentsOMA | F1 2025 | Season 13
